Abstract

In recent years, various types of small electronic devices have become widespread. Optical wireless power-transmission (OWPT) systems can be charged over long distances and are promising candidates for systems that do not require dry batteries. In this study, we propose a wireless power-transmission method for supplying power to small electronic devices and demonstrate wireless power transmission. A crystalline Si (c-Si) solar cell and power-storage device incorporated into small electronic devices enable optical wireless power transmission systems using near-infrared LED lights and can be used to eliminate dry batteries.
